Dark Green

The color #225931 is a dark green that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 34, 89, 49 and HSL values of 136°, 45%, 24%.

Complementary Colors for #225931

The complementary color for #225931 is #59224A.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#225931

The analogous colors for #225931 are #2F5922 and #22594C.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#225931

The triadic colors for #225931 are #302259 and #593022.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.
